DKSH Achieves Milestone with SBTi Approval for Emissions Targets
DKSH Management Ltd. has received validation from the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i) for its near-term and net-zero emissions targets. This approval underscores DKSH's dedication to climate goals and its objective to reach net-zero emissions by 2050. The approval aligns DKSH’s climate objectives with current scientific standards.
The company aims to reduce its Scope 1 and 2 emissions by 71.2% by 2030, using a 2020 baseline. Additionally, there is a pledge to cut Scope 3 emissions from purchased goods by 61.1% per CHF of value added by 2033, based on 2024 figures. Measures include optimizing transport routes, utilizing renewable energy, and investing in carbon removal projects.
CEO Stefan P. Butz emphasized that the approval enhances DKSH’s sustainability efforts and strengthens its climate ambition. The company has already achieved a 55% reduction in Scope 1 and 2 emissions since 2020.
